DEV Community

Cover image for 11 Best Courses for AWS Developer in 2026
Stack Overflowed
Stack Overflowed

Posted on

11 Best Courses for AWS Developer in 2026

The first time I touched AWS as a developer, I thought it’d be easy. Spin up an EC2 instance, connect it to S3, throw in a DynamoDB table—done. Right? Instead, I was knee-deep in IAM permission errors, tangled VPCs, and a bill that made me double-check my credit card. What should have been a fun side project turned into weeks of trial and error.

That’s when I realized AWS isn’t something you can “just figure out” by piecing together random blog posts. It’s too big, too interconnected. You need a roadmap—and good courses give you exactly that.

In 2026, AWS will remain the market leader in cloud computing, and the AWS Developer Associate certification is one of the most in-demand credentials out there. But certification is just one piece. As developers, we need to know how to actually build on AWS: serverless APIs, event-driven systems, CI/CD pipelines, and scalable apps.

That’s why I pulled together this list of the best courses for AWS developer. My top pick is Educative.io’s Master AWS Certified Developer, because it balances interactive learning with practical projects. But I’ve also included other solid paths from Udemy, Coursera, A Cloud Guru, and even AWS itself.


1. Master AWS Certified Developer – Educative.io (Top Pick)

If you hate spending hours setting up labs just to learn, this is the course for you. Educative runs entirely in the browser, so you can jump straight into coding.

The course is designed for the Developer Associate certification, but it’s not just exam cramming. You’ll actually use AWS services as a developer: Lambda, DynamoDB, S3, API Gateway, IAM, and more. Interactive coding challenges let you practice without needing your own AWS account.

This is one of the best courses for AWS developer if you want a no-friction way to both prepare for certification and gain hands-on experience.


2. AWS Certified Developer Associate – Udemy (Stephane Maarek)

Stephane Maarek’s AWS courses are almost legendary at this point. His Developer Associate course is detailed, approachable, and regularly updated.

You’ll work through IAM policies, serverless systems, CI/CD with CodePipeline, and scaling strategies. The mix of theory and demos makes AWS concepts click.

If you prefer video-based learning and want tons of peer reviews to back it up, this is one of the best courses for AWS developer you can grab.


3. AWS Developer: Building on AWS – Coursera (AWS Training & Certification)

Want something official? AWS itself designed this course with Coursera. It focuses on using AWS SDKs, Elastic Beanstalk, and serverless systems.

The value here is that you’re learning directly from AWS trainers. That makes this one of the best courses for AWS developer if you want vendor-approved training with a structured format.


4. Developer Learning Path – AWS Skill Builder

Skill Builder is AWS’s own learning platform. Their Developer Learning Path is basically a guided curriculum: fundamentals, event-driven design, serverless, and microservices.

The free tier gives you basics, while the paid tier unlocks labs and practice exams. For anyone who prefers learning straight from the source, this is one of the best courses for AWS developer.


5. AWS Developer Associate Prep – A Cloud Guru

A Cloud Guru (formerly Linux Academy) is built for hands-on learners. Their AWS Developer Associate track uses real cloud labs instead of just slides.

You’ll practice deploying serverless APIs, managing CI/CD pipelines, and working with DynamoDB. This makes it one of the best courses for AWS developer if you want to learn by doing instead of just watching.


6. Serverless Framework Bootcamp – Udemy

Let’s be honest: a lot of AWS dev work is now serverless. This course focuses specifically on the Serverless Framework for deploying Lambda, DynamoDB, and API Gateway apps.

If you’re working on modern, event-driven apps, this is one of the best courses for AWS developer to specialize in.


7. AWS Fundamentals Specialization – Coursera

This specialization is a collection of courses built by AWS. It covers compute, storage, networking, and databases, with a strong developer focus.

It’s beginner-friendly and structured, making it one of the best courses for AWS developer if you want a broad foundation before diving deeper.


8. AWS Cloud Practitioner Essentials – AWS (Free)

If AWS feels overwhelming, this free course is a gentle introduction. It explains global infrastructure, core services, and the pricing model in plain terms.

It’s not developer-specific, but it’s one of the best courses for AWS developer if you’re just starting out and need to demystify AWS before touching Lambda or DynamoDB.


9. AWS Developer Tools Deep Dive – Pluralsight

While many courses skim over AWS’s dev tools, Pluralsight goes deep. This course covers CodeBuild, CodeDeploy, and CodePipeline—all critical for real-world AWS workflows.

If CI/CD is part of your daily work, this is one of the best courses for AWS developer to sharpen your toolset.


10. Hands-On AWS for Developers – LinkedIn Learning

Short on time? This LinkedIn Learning course gives a compact but useful overview of AWS SDKs, S3, DynamoDB, and serverless services.

It’s not as in-depth as the big bootcamps, but it’s one of the best courses for AWS developer if you want a quick professional refresher.


11. AWS Certified Developer Official Practice – AWS Training

This one isn’t a full course—it’s AWS’s own practice exam. But pairing it with a full learning path is the best way to simulate the real test and find weak spots.

It rounds out the list as one of the best courses for AWS developer prep strategies.


Choosing the Best Course for AWS Developer

So where should you start?

  • Total beginner? Try AWS Cloud Practitioner Essentials or Educative’s Cloud Computing for Developers for the basics.
  • Certification focused? Go with Educative.io’s Master AWS Certified Developer or Stephane Maarek’s Udemy course.
  • Hands-on learner? Check out A Cloud Guru or Pluralsight’s dev tools courses.
  • Interested in serverless? The Udemy Serverless Bootcamp is your best bet.
  • Want official AWS content? Skill Builder or Coursera’s AWS courses are reliable choices.

Wrapping Up

AWS can feel like drinking from a firehose. IAM, EC2, Lambda, DynamoDB, VPCs, CI/CD pipelines—it’s a lot. The right course helps you cut through the overwhelm and focus on what matters.

The best courses for AWS developer don’t just get you past an exam—they show you how to build apps, deploy them, and keep them running in production.

If you’re not sure where to begin, I’d recommend Educative.io’s Master AWS Certified Developer. It’s interactive, practical, and gives you the skills you’ll actually use. From there, you can branch into certifications, serverless specialties, or advanced DevOps workflows.

Pretty soon, AWS won’t feel like a confusing maze—it’ll feel like a toolkit you actually know how to use.

Which AWS course or resource helped you finally connect the dots? Drop your recommendations in the comments—your path might be exactly what another dev needs to hear.

Top comments (0)